SimpleModal 是 JQuery 還算蠻好用的套件

demo 如下

http://www.ericmmartin.com/projects/simplemodal-demos/

 

就這樣用

      $("#open_sites").modal({
          close :false,
          onOpen: function (dialog) {
           dialog.overlay.fadeIn('slow', function () {
        dialog.data.hide();
        dialog.container.fadeIn('slow', function () {
       dialog.data.slideDown('slow');
        });
        });      
          }
      }); 

本來在 chrome + firefox 都好好的,跑到 IE 又有問題

錯誤訊息 : 未執行    

這錯誤訊息真是淺顯易懂

 

Clipboard02.jpg            

 

然後找了好久找到解決方式

http://code.google.com/p/simplemodal/issues/detail?id=7

 

有人講了下面這段話

 

Still a problem in 1.3.5 with jQuery 1.4.2. Issue identified in comment #1. Solution there was to set ieQuirks = false, however, that may break in earlier versions of IE. 

Suggest change from:
ieQuirks = $.browser.msie && !$.boxModel;

To: 
ieQuirks = jQuery.support.boxModel; 

Tested in IE8 Standards mode, IE7 compatibility mode, Firefox 3.6.6, Opera 10.51, Google Chrome 5.0.375.99

 

然後就莫名奇妙結案了

arrow
arrow
    全站熱搜
    創作者介紹
    創作者 小雕 的頭像
    小雕

    小雕雕的家

    小雕 發表在 痞客邦 留言(0) 人氣()